To produce, develop and preserve helpful relationships with the media, a media relations manager need to provide a reliable method.
Here are some of the most reliable methods to develop your media relations technique: Pitching to the best media contact is a vital part of obtaining press protection. You'll need to understand which news outlets would be finest matched to the sort of story you're producing. For example, if you have a fitness product, you should target a health editor, instead of a politics editor.
Spending as much time as possible looking into the appropriate press reporter for your story will make your pitches more successful. A big part of efficient media relations is understanding the sort of material a journalist produces and publishes. A media list is also understood as a press list. It's efficiently a contact list containing info about journalists who would be interested in covering your newspaper article.
These reporters would typically compose about your area of proficiency, specific niche or business industry. Research study contact information, beats, titles and any stories that a specific press reporter might have published previously. This information will assist to make certain you're getting the right media support for your target audience. You'll maximize each pitch, and amass the best interest, every time.

A press or news page, often called a "Press Room" or "Media Center," is a devoted area on your organization's site.
This page offers reporters, bloggers, and other media professionals easy access to your business's essential info. Creating this page and positioning it in an easy-to-spot put on your website lets media specialists rapidly see your news release and other newsworthy material. That said, here are some crucial ideas to think about before your press/news page goes live: Constantly upload news release in Word format (and never ever as PDFs) to make them easy for journalists to copy.

Getting ready for your pitch is essential to guaranteeing a positive response and optimizing your chances of media protection. Determine and investigate a specific reporter to comprehend their beat and audience. This will assist you tailor your pitch to the journalist's interests, making it more appropriate and engaging. Then, craft a succinct and clear message, highlighting the newsworthy aspects of your story and why it matters to their audience.
Lastly, practice your pitch to ensure you can provide it confidently and plainly, whether it's through e-mail, phone, or in-person conferences.
